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0295966 13065500 4821473
084767 0305 65
084767 0305 65
5529434639 23 414730587 1958 7340761
All about undefined
Interested in learning more?
084767 0305 65
5529434639 23 414730587 1958 7340761
See more
6902302307 231
6257 9844 91703 67 73
See more
222342113 596241
34587 2347345 779536066
See more